Command & Conquer 3: Kane's Wrath for Xbox 360Kane is invading the Xbox 360, and he’s bringing the ultimate console RTS experience with him! The follow up to last year’s Command & Conquer 3: Tiberium Wars (isn’t required to play Kane’s Wrath), Kane’s Wrath has gone gold for the Xbox 360, and will be shipping on June 23, 2008 at a price of $39.99. Gamers who pre-order Kane’s Wrath from Gamestop.com will receive an exclusive talking Kane Bobblehead doll (available while supplies last).

Featuring the all-new CommandStick interface, a revolutionary control scheme built from the ground up and optimized for the Xbox 360, Kane’s Wrath is packed full of content, including a full 13 mission story-driven campaign, the Xbox 360-exclusive Kane’s Challenge* mode, six new diverse sub-factions, game changing epic units and over 50 multiplayer maps for online play over Xbox LIVE with up to four players. It also comes with 1000 achievement points spread across the game’s four main game modes (Campaign, Kane’s Challenge, Skirmish and Multiplayer) and support for the console’s Vision Cam over Xbox LIVE. Although it’s missing the PC version’s Global Conquest mode, which didn’t control well on a console.

* Kane’s Challenge is a “gauntlet of skirmish matches” with the player taking control of one of nine armies (the three original factions are present as well as six new sub-factions). Competing in a series of single matches, the player must climb a ladder, unlocking achievements and more along the way. “It’s a great way to learn about RTS games” said the game’s producer Jim Vessella, who confirmed there will be 20 new videos of Kane to be unlocked as you progress through Kane’s Challenge, with the baldy one either offering support or pouring scorn on your efforts. — Via PR & Strategyinformer
